-
公开(公告)号:CN117274538A
公开(公告)日:2023-12-22
申请号:CN202311561099.8
申请日:2023-11-22
Applicant: 中国空气动力研究与发展中心计算空气动力研究所
IPC: G06T17/20 , G06F30/23 , G06F30/28 , G06F111/10 , G06F113/08 , G06F113/28 , G06F119/14
Abstract: 本申请公开了一种空间混合网格的生成方法、装置、终端设备和介质,该方法包括:根据导入的模型,生成非结构附面层网格;根据非结构附面层网格,生成外部空间的自适应笛卡尔网格,对自适应笛卡尔网格进行挖洞处理,得到与自适应笛卡尔网格对应的笛卡尔网格前锋面;根据笛卡尔网格前锋面,生成金字塔网格;根据金字塔网格的前锋面和非结构附面层网格,确定金字塔网格的前锋面和非结构附面层网格之间的填充网格;根据非结构附面层网格、填充网格和自适应笛卡尔网格,确定空间混合网格,由于非结构网格和笛卡尔网格能够自动生成,自动化程度更高,生成的网格质量好。
-
公开(公告)号:CN117272523A
公开(公告)日:2023-12-22
申请号:CN202311561101.1
申请日:2023-11-22
Applicant: 中国空气动力研究与发展中心计算空气动力研究所
IPC: G06F30/15 , G06F30/28 , G06F30/23 , G06T17/20 , G06F111/10 , G06F113/08 , G06F119/14 , G06F113/28
Abstract: 本申请公开了一种飞行器稳定性参数的确定方法、装置、终端设备和介质,通过根据飞行器模型,生成表面离散网格;根据预设网格生成参数和表面离散网格,确定与飞行器模型对应的目标空间网格;根据飞行器运动参数和气动力模型,确定气动力参数公式;根据目标空间网格、气动参数和飞行器运动参数,确定非定常流场数据和气动力数据;根据非定常流场数据、气动力数据和气动力参数公式,计算飞行器模型的稳定性参数,通过笛卡尔网格技术实现,在自适应生成的笛卡尔网格上进行非定常流场的计算,再提取用于稳定性参数辨识的气动力数据,由于笛卡尔网格可完全自动化生成,使得该方法具有自动化程度相对传统方法更高、人工干预更少的优点。
-
公开(公告)号:CN116702657A
公开(公告)日:2023-09-05
申请号:CN202310981558.1
申请日:2023-08-07
Applicant: 中国空气动力研究与发展中心计算空气动力研究所
IPC: G06F30/28 , G06F30/12 , G06F111/20 , G06F119/14 , G06F113/08
Abstract: 本申请公开了一种针对大规模网格的人机交互方法、装置、设备及介质,涉及计算流体力学领域,包括:获取待进行人机交互的模型文件,并根据模型文件对应的网格数据创建捕获包围盒,并将捕获包围盒与固定深度的R树绑定;根据网格数据创建可视化数据对象并将其添加到固定深度的R树的叶子节点中;将固定深度的R树上每个节点绑定的捕获包围盒作为捕获对象,并将捕获对象添加到OpenGL中,以对可视化数据对象进行捕获拾取,并将捕获到的可视化数据对象反馈到用户界面。本申请根据模型对应的网格数据的尺寸创建捕获包围盒,并与固定深度的R树绑定,能够在满足不同用户显卡配置的基础上,实现大规模网格的高效人机交互。
-
公开(公告)号:CN115587552B
公开(公告)日:2023-03-28
申请号:CN202211588003.2
申请日:2022-12-12
Applicant: 中国空气动力研究与发展中心计算空气动力研究所
IPC: G06F30/28 , G06T17/20 , G06F113/08
Abstract: 本申请公开了一种网格优化方法、装置、终端设备及存储介质,通过获取模型文件,并根据模型文件,确定与模型文件对应的初始空间离散网格;根据预先设置的流场的流动参数和初始空间离散网格,确定当前时刻的流场结果;根据当前时刻的流场结果,确定预设区域的特征结构识别参数;根据特征结构识别参数,对初始空间离散网格进行优化,本申请实施例通过引入自适应技术,即在流场计算过程中对流场变化较大的位置进行自动加密网格,基于流场实时计算结果动态优化网格,确保流场特征较高精度捕捉,且网格分布和规模合理。
-
公开(公告)号:CN115238331B
公开(公告)日:2023-01-06
申请号:CN202211092883.4
申请日:2022-09-08
Applicant: 中国空气动力研究与发展中心计算空气动力研究所
IPC: G06F30/12 , G06F111/20
Abstract: 本发明公开了一种CAD图形处理方法、装置、设备和存储介质。该方法包括:获取显示界面上构成第一CAD图形的线;获取用户输入的第一参数;根据第一参数将第一CAD图形中目标距离小于或者等于所述第一参数的线进行虚拟合并,得到第二CAD图形;获取第二CAD图形的拓扑面和拓扑环的映射关系;根据第二CAD图形的拓扑面和拓扑环的映射关系对第二CAD图形的拓扑面进行筛选,得到第三CAD图形;获取第三CAD图形的拓扑环和拓扑线的映射关系,与拓扑线和拓扑点的映射关系;根据第三CAD图形的拓扑环和拓扑线的映射关系,与拓扑线和拓扑点的映射关系对第三CAD图形的拓扑线进行筛选,得到目标CAD图形。本发明实施例可屏蔽各建模软件之间因精度差异、建模等导致的脏几何问题。
-
公开(公告)号:CN114996858B
公开(公告)日:2022-10-25
申请号:CN202210823106.6
申请日:2022-07-14
Applicant: 中国空气动力研究与发展中心计算空气动力研究所
IPC: G06F30/15 , G06F30/28 , G06F113/08 , G06F119/14
Abstract: 本发明涉及一种飞行器仿真方法、装置、终端设备和存储介质,通过获取目标气动参数、目标结构参数和目标时间段;将目标气动参数和目标结构参数输入到飞行器模型,生成初始笛卡尔网格;根据空间网格和目标气动参数进行CFD计算,得到当前时刻的流动状态信息;根据结构动力学方程和目标结构参数,确定结构应力信息和位移信息;在目标时间段内,根据流动状态信息、结构应力和位移信息对初始笛卡尔网格进行更新,本发明实施例借助自适应笛卡尔网格技术实现气动和结构两者网格的一体化生成,并在统一的网格下开展计算。本发明实施例使用的笛卡尔网格的能够自动生成,并且无需在不同的计算软件之间人工传递数据,自动化程度更高。
-
公开(公告)号:CN114492249B
公开(公告)日:2022-07-05
申请号:CN202210340318.9
申请日:2022-04-02
Applicant: 中国空气动力研究与发展中心计算空气动力研究所
IPC: G06F30/28 , G06F113/08 , G06F119/14
Abstract: 本发明实施例提供了一种非结构网格的生成方法、系统、客户端及服务器,本方案中,第一方面,客户端生成初始空间网格、将初始空间网格中的表面网格和空间外表面网格进行替换,这些过程的数据处理量较小,客户端能够满足这种数据处理需求。第二方面,客户端向服务器传输初始空间网格,服务器向客户端传输合并表面网格和合并空间外表面网格,而不是传输全部的细分空间网格,初始空间网格、合并表面网格和合并空间外表面网格的数据量均较小,因此,客户端与服务器之间传输的数据量较小。
-
公开(公告)号:CN111538487B
公开(公告)日:2022-06-14
申请号:CN202010303255.0
申请日:2020-04-17
Applicant: 中国空气动力研究与发展中心计算空气动力研究所
Abstract: 本发明公开了一种分布式并行网格生成软件框架,包括具有可视化数据管理功能、且具有图形人机交互界面的客户端模块,用于执行异步消息收发操作、和可视化数据序列化操作的消息中间模块,以并行方式运行在计算集群上,支持分布式网格数据管理,执行网格并行生成功能的服务端模块。本发明满足大规模CFD应用对网格的巨大需求,用户能随时随地访问网格生成服务。它具有友好的图形用户界面(GUI),用户可以与之交互并驱动所提供的功能。
-
公开(公告)号:CN113343328A
公开(公告)日:2021-09-03
申请号:CN202110634535.4
申请日:2021-06-08
Applicant: 中国空气动力研究与发展中心计算空气动力研究所
Abstract: 本发明具体涉及一种基于改进牛顿迭代的高效最近点投影方法。包括,步骤1:对原始CAD数模曲面应用超限插值法,得到三维空间点,连接得到三维网格;步骤2:原始CAD数模曲面进行离散并对其参数进行归一化处理,建立搜索树;步骤3:利用搜索树搜索距离待投影点最近的离散点,以待投影点与最近离散点距离为半径获得剪裁球,获得筛选面及对应面上搜索到的离散点;步骤4:以筛选后的每个面最近点作为初始迭代值,循环交替迭代后取最近距离点为最终的投影点。步骤5:将得到的投影点替换三维空间点,得到贴紧数模表面的网格。本发明的网格质量好,能更精准的逼近数模表面,在真实几何模型的计算效率更高,具有更好的鲁棒性,能处理不连续曲面。
-
公开(公告)号:CN112632869A
公开(公告)日:2021-04-09
申请号:CN202011546611.8
申请日:2020-12-23
Applicant: 中国空气动力研究与发展中心计算空气动力研究所
IPC: G06F30/28 , G06F113/08 , G06F119/14
Abstract: 本发明公开了一种基于网格框架的非结构附面层网格生成方法,包括以下步骤:S1.利用Pointwise进行数模离散,生成表面网格并作为方法的输入;S2.根据表面网格的几何特征提取出支撑点,再通过支撑点与其法向量计算出框架支撑线;S3.通过径向基函数插值方法得到轮廓线;S4.在轮廓线和表面网格的基础上,再次利用径向基函数插值得到附面层顶层网格;S5.通过一种线性插值生成附面层内部网格。通过对生成的自动性和对局部网格质量的控制能力进行仿真实验可以看出本发明的方法所生成网格的精度满足使用要求。
-
-
-
-
-
-
-
-
-